EastEnders viewers were left stunned as Jasmine Fisher confessed to causing harm to Cindy Beale, but fans reckon they've sussed out her true identity.
In Monday's episode (November 24), newcomer Jasmine (played by Indeyarna Donaldson-Holness) continued her strange obsession with Cindy (Michelle Collins), which didn't go unnoticed.
After realising that her National Insurance number was incorrect, Cindy suspected Jasmine might be linked to Jackie Ford. Cindy confronted Jasmine about her real identity, leading to a dramatic tumble down the stairs.
On Tuesday (November 25), Oscar Branning (Pierre Moullier) found Cindy unconscious on the pavement and dashed to the Beales' house to alert them.
The family rushed to the hospital while Oscar went back to find Jasmine hastily packing her bags to leave. He questioned her involvement in Cindy's accident, leading her to confess that she had pushed Cindy down the stairs, reports OK!.
Despite Jasmine insisting it was self-defence against Cindy, Oscar believed the incident was purely accidental.
Meanwhile, Cindy underwent surgery for her injured elbow, but Ian Beale (Adam Woodyatt) revealed doctors were worried about potential complications.
Following a successful operation, Cindy remained in hospital overnight – but received an unexpected visitor. Jasmine stood over Cindy's bed before departing, though Cindy regained consciousness and witnessed her leaving.
As Jasmine didn't harm Cindy, some EastEnders viewers are convinced the pair aren't connected.
In a surprising turn, fans are now speculating that Jasmine is seeking revenge on her biological mum Zoe Slater (Michelle Ryan), who is presently being tormented by an unknown individual.
